Who Are We?
 

Nu-Way Operation BHILDis a 501(c)(3) non-profit social organization that serves the community by offering programs which help individuals to get along socially. It was established in [1991] and has been responsible for serving our community by offering programs that aid in it's residents learning how to get along socially. We are most known for our Heritage Day Festival & Parade which is held annually on the last Saturday in the month of February.
